We offer both transmissions -but it isn't as simple as "auto is better for the strip and manual for the road course" -- trust me on this.

Our engineers spent a lot of time developing shift algorithms -- and until you actually drive a ZL1 with an automatic transmission, you have no real appreciation for the job they've done.

You see - as you 'tap down' -- the controller 'blips' the throttle - just as you would with heel/toe shifts - except that a lot of people have problems with heel/toe shifts. The fastest way around the road course is to keep the car balanced......and this is what helps to keep the ZL1 balanced.

A trip around the track with guys like Aaron Link or Tony Roma or Mark Stielow or Mark Dickens or Al Oppenheiser will demonstrate just how great the Automatic Transmissioned ZL1 truly is.

Now - are there drivers out there that can perhaps drive the manual transmissioned ZL1 faster than the automatic? Yes -- but I think the numbers are limited.
